Benefits of Running Machine Incline
Boosted Caloric Burn
Running or walking on an incline can elevate the heart rate and increase caloric expenditure. By mimicing uphill surface, the body works harder, leading to increased energy expense during the exercise. Research study recommends an incline boost of just 1% can result in a noteworthy increase in calories burned.
Enhanced Muscle Engagement
Utilizing the incline function engages numerous muscle groups more than level running. It primarily targets the calves, hamstrings, glutes, and quadriceps, leading to improved strength and endurance gradually. The included resistance challenges the muscles, helping them grow stronger and more toned.
Minimized Impact on Joints

Increased Cardiovascular Health
The incline setting can elevate the heart rate, offering cardiovascular benefits comparable to those acquired from high-intensity period training (HIIT). Regularly including incline training into workouts can assist enhance physical fitness and heart health.
Variety and Motivation
Among the main challenges of maintaining an indoor exercise regimen is boredom. Changing in between different incline levels not only adds range to an exercise but also keeps users engaged and motivated. Whether it's a high incline or a steady increase, varying the regimen can elicit better general performance.
Imitating Outdoor Running Conditions

This can be especially beneficial for getting ready for events that involve hill runs.Efficient Ways to Incorporate Incline Into Your Workout
Hill Intervals: Alternate in between high-intensity running on an incline and durations of walking or flat going to produce a difficult interval exercise.

Steady-State Incline Run: Set a moderate incline (around 3-5%) and maintain a constant rate for extended durations to build endurance.

Incline Walk: For newbies or those trying to find a low-impact choice, walking on an incline can supply an energetic exercise without the stress of running.

Incline Pyramid Workout: Gradually increase the incline every few minutes until reaching a peak before slowly decreasing back to absolutely no. This challenges the body while enhancing endurance.

Incline Sprints: Incorporate short and quick sprints on a high incline followed by recovery durations. This can help enhance speed and cardiovascular health.
Recommendations for Incline Training
Start Slow: For beginners, it's essential to slowly present incline into workouts. Starting with a small incline (1-2%) can help the body get accustomed to the change.

Concentrate on Form: The incline can alter running form. Keep an upright posture, avoid leaning too far forward, and keep a natural stride to avoid injury.

Heat up and Cool Down: Always warm up before starting an incline workout and cool down afterward to allow the heart rate to go back to regular and prevent prospective muscle pressure.

Monitor Heart Rate: Keeping track of the heart rate during incline workouts can assist ensure that users are working out within suitable strength levels for their fitness objectives.

Hydrate: Considerable sweating might take place during incline exercises, so staying hydrated is important for efficiency and recovery.
Frequently Asked Questions About Running Machine Incline1. Is it much better to walk or run on an incline?
Both walking and operating on an incline supply distinct advantages. Walking is low-impact and more accessible for beginners, while running elevates heart rate and burns more calories in a much shorter period. The very best choice depends upon private fitness objectives and physical fitness.
2. How steep should I set the incline?
For beginners, beginning with an incline of 1-2% is advisable. As strength and conditioning improve, gradually increasing the incline to 5-10% can make the most of advantages.
3. Can I use the incline function for my whole workout?
Incorporating the incline for the whole workout can be beneficial, but it is also important to mix in periods of flat running or walking to stabilize the workout and decrease the danger of injury.
4. How much extra calories can I burn by using the incline?
The calorie burn is influenced by different aspects such as body weight, workout intensity, and period. Generally, operating on an incline can increase calorie burn by approximately 10-30% compared to performing at a flat level.
5. Is it safe to work on a high incline?
While working on a steep incline can offer exceptional advantages, it's crucial to listen to the body and guarantee correct type. Individuals with pre-existing conditions or injuries should speak with a health care professional before taking part in high-incline workouts.
